The Science Behind Our Residential Water Damage Restoration Process
With water damage, every minute counts. That’s why our team follows a strict process to ensure that your home is restored as quickly and effectively as possible. From initial assessment to final cleanup, our process is designed to get you back to normal as fast as possible.
Step 1: Emergency Response
Within 60 minutes of your call, our team will arrive on the scene to assess the damage and begin the restoration process. Our equipment includes advanced moisture detection tools and industrial-grade pumps to extract water quickly and efficiently.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water from your home, including wet vacuums and pumps.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air, ensuring that your home dries quickly and thoroughly.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the drying process is complete, we’ll clean and sanitize all aff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your home is safe and secure. We’ll also make any necessary repairs to get your home back to its original condition.

Don’t Ignore These Warning Signs of Water Damage
Water damage can be sneaky, but it’s essential to catch it early to prevent costly repairs down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old growth or water damage.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s time to call in the experts.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le, leading to costly repairs if left unchecked.
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ains can be a sign of a larger issue, so don’t ignore them, call us today to assess the dam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el, flake, or blister. If you notice this in your home, it’s time to call in the experts.
Visible Water Stains or Leaks
Don’t ignore visible water stains or leaks, they can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ards if left unchecked.

Residential Water Damage Restoration Cost in Farmersville, TX
The cost of Residential Water Damage Restoration can vary widely depending on the severity and scope of the damage, as well as local conditions in the area.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water extracted and the equipment needed to do so.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ry it.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the materials needed to clean and sanitize it. |
| Final Inspection and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the repairs needed to restore the area. |
